Output 89671b0c4e8a5a8b247bd5c9a431818f56ea05fc2cb47fe3d3eec27e354da64a:0

value
20589240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f5da632807c6cfb22522492bc778b155dff1d83 OP_EQUAL
address
361TsRMwdtAt6t2aRozV5Hw52qNDeGJtjh
transaction
89671b0c4e8a5a8b247bd5c9a431818f56ea05fc2cb47fe3d3eec27e354da64a
spent
true